
April 24, 2007
WEST WINDSOR, N.J. -- The Fairfield University women's rowing team placed fourth at the 2007 Metro Atlantic Athletic Conference (MAAC) championships, highlighted by a first-place finish by the junior varsity 4+. The Stags combined for 106 total points, compiled by their finishes in five separate events.
The JV 4 captured the team's only gold medal by crossing the finish line with a time of 8:18.3. The shell included Liz Ulles, Sam Rosen, Becca Bowes, and Mallory Reimers. The Stags also sent another entry into the race, which placed third overall. The team was comprised by Sara LaFouci, Mary Crowley, Jess Braveman, and Lindsey Ryan.
The novice 4 just missed gold by taking second place in its event, courtesy of a strong effort from Emily Petrow, Alysse Merullo, Diana Wescott, and Lauren Lipyanka. The Stags finished the race in 8:32.26, just a few seconds off leader Loyola (8:28.69).
The novice 8 started the day off for Fairfield with a second-place finish with a time of 8:12.18, trailing only Loyola College (7:55.2). The Stags entry included Emily Petrow, Mary McGrath, Diana Wescott, Lauren Lipyanka, Karisten Strong, Caitlen Gallagher, Courtney McCord, and Alyesse Merullo.
The varsity 8 secured third place with a time of 7:36.65, as Marist won the event with a time of 7:15.26. The shell consisted of Sara LaFouci, Mary Crowley, Jess Braveman, Lindsey Ryan, Becca Bowes, Sam Rosen, Liz Ulles, and Christina DiCioccio.
Fairfield placed two entries in the varsity 4, which resulted in a fourth and fifth place finish. The fourth-place shell included Sara LaFouci, Mary Crowley, Liz Ulles, and Sam Rosen, which recorded a time of 8:24.98. The "B" boat was just one-plus seconds later in the standing after a strong showing from Becca Bowes, Lindsey Ryan, Jess Braveman, and Mallory Reimers.
The Stags finish the regular season on May 11 and 12 in Philadelphia, competing in the prestigious Dad Vails.
